Welcome to the Boysen Memorial, an international athletics meeting held at Bislett Stadium in Oslo, Norway.
The 2026 edition will take place on Wednesday June 24th and is part of the World Athletics Continental Tour Bronze.
Event Overview
- Location: Bislett Stadium, Oslo
- Date: June 24th 2026
- Competition Level: Bronze
- Organiser: Tjalve
The Boysen Memorial is one of Norway’s premier athletics meetings, attracting both national and international athletes across track and field events.
Competition Programme
Women
A Events: 400 m, 800 m, Long Jump, Javelin
B Events: 100 m, 200 m, 1500 m, 400 m Hurdles
Men
A Events: 200 m, 800 m, 5000 m, Hammer
B Events: 100 m, 400 m, Long Jump
Relay: 4x100m
Mix
4x400m
Final event schedule and start lists will be published closer to the competition date.

Prize Money & Awards
Prize money will be awarded according to the meeting’s official prize structure.
| Place | A -Events | B -Events |
| 1st | 1000 EUR | 500 EUR |
| 2nd | 600 EUR | 400 EUR |
| 3rd | 400 EUR | 300 EUR |
| 4th | 300 EUR | 200 EUR |
| 5th | 200 EUR | 100 EUR |
Boysen Award – 800 m
An additional performance bonus will be awarded for outstanding results:
- Men: Sub 1:45.90
- Women: Sub 2:01.00
Bonus: 10,000 NOK (approx €1,000)
Tax
Tax rate in Norway is 15% which will be deducted from the prize money. For travel reimbursement there is no tax deduction. All payments shall be done within 90 days.
